Key Price Drivers in Outdoor Patio Furniture

Understanding what moves the price tag helps you decide where to spend and where to save. Frame construction, material durability, hardware, and finish quality are the main factors, followed by brand reputation and included features. These attributes explain most large price differences between otherwise similar-looking pieces.

Material and Construction

Material choice strongly affects cost and longevity. Aluminum frames are generally affordable, low maintenance, and resist rust. Steel frames provide greater structural strength but can require protective finishes. Wicker-style pieces may use synthetic fibers that last outdoors, while treated hardwood options offer higher initial costs but long-term appeal when properly maintained. Cushion density and fabric quality also change comfort, maintenance needs, and price.

Hardware and Mechanisms

Reliable hardware—hinges, glides, adjustment controls, and fasteners—reduces long-term repair risk. Better mechanisms in recliners, tables, and modular sets add to upfront cost but often reduce replacement frequency and frustration. Expect higher prices where mechanisms are smoother, more stable, and backed by clear performance details.

Smart Comparison Strategies

Systematic comparison prevents overpaying and helps clarify value. Define the essentials, collect options, and evaluate them by price per feature, durability indicators, and total cost of ownership rather than relying on a single glance at the tag or cart price.

  • Set a realistic budget range tied to how often you will use the pieces and how long you plan to keep them.
  • Shortlist three to five options that meet your essential requirements in size, material, and function.
  • Compare identical configurations, including cushions, covers, and warranties.
  • Factor delivery, assembly, and local taxes into the total cost when feasible.

Where to Look and When to Buy

Best prices on outdoor patio furniture appear at different places depending on timing and product type. Large seasonal promotions, end-of-model-year clearances, and loyalty programs often produce the lowest prices on specific items, while smaller, value-focused sellers can offer better everyday deals on simpler products.

Timing and Promotions

Plan around major sale windows—early spring, holiday weekends, and late-season clearance—when many retailers lower prices on remaining stock or introduce new discounts. Price-match guarantees, coupon stacking, and member-only offers can further improve deals during these periods. For less seasonal categories, smaller price adjustments may occur more frequently rather than one annual event.

Retail Options

  • Big-box and online marketplaces for broad selection, occasional deep discounts, and comparison convenience.
  • Brand direct sites for promotions, extended warranties, and clearer warranty terms.
  • Local specialty stores for service, advice, and immediate ownership without shipping complexity.
  • Secondhand and refurbished options for budget-conscious buyers willing to inspect condition and materials.
